The device in question is the Libre Duo 10 Day monitor . Worn on your arm as
a continuous glucose monitor (CGM) , it provides minute-by-minute glucose updates that are sent to your smartphone . It also monitors ketone levels and sends you an alert if they rise above a certain threshold. In terms of who
can use it, the Libre Duo 10 Day wearable has been approved for use by people aged two or over who are living with diabetes. It takes the form of a small wearable sensor that measures glucose and ketone levels held within the

Simplifying the process (Image credit: Abbott Diabetes Care) In approving the Libre Duo 10 Day, the FDAs intention is to help prevent diabetic ketoacidosis (DKA). This condition occurs when your body starts using fat instead of glucose for energy, which

One of the benefits of the Libre Duo 10 Day is that it can track ketone
levels in real time. Rather than using a standalone test kit that only provides a snapshot of your situation in that exact moment, the Libre
wearable can display trends over time, notifying you if your ketone levels
are rising or falling which could help keep you better informed of whether your risk of DKA is changing.
The fact that it combines ketone monitoring with blood sugar analysis also means you dont need two separate devices in order to stay on top of your diabetes. We dont know when the Libre Duo 10 Day will become available, and its manufacturers website simply says it is coming soon. When it does arrive, it might help simplify the process of ketone and blood sugar monitoring for the 2.1 million Americans with type 1 diabetes for whom DKA is a real threat.
